电力系统灵活性及其评价综述A Survey on Power System Flexibility and Its Evaluations
肖定垚;王承民;曾平良;孙伟卿;段建民;
摘要(Abstract):
随着电力系统不确定性的不断增加,电力系统需要具备一定的应变和响应能力,即所谓的灵活性,以尽可能消除或减小以上不确定因素带来的负面影响,保证电力系统的安全稳定运行。介绍了电力系统灵活性的特点与定义,将电力系统灵活性分为输电系统灵活性、配电系统灵活性和输电及配电系统双端灵活性3个方面,较为全面地对可控性较强的可再生能源的接入、储能、负荷管理和负荷响应、微网等可用的灵活性资源进行分类与阐述,介绍它们之间的交叉应用,并对它们提高电力系统灵活性的能力进行了概述;此外,简要介绍了现有的灵活性评价指标,着重介绍了IRRE和TUSFI-TEUSFI两大指标,并指出了它们的适用范围。最后,对电力系统灵活性的研究进行了展望,并阐述了灵活性指标的建立与优化过程中需要关注的问题。
关键词(KeyWords): 电力系统灵活性;大规模可再生能源;负荷管理和负荷响应;储能;微网
